Representatives for the 2008 Game Developers Conference have announced five new members of its advisory board, including Blizzard's Rob Pardo, Square Enix's Ichiro Otobe, and key figures from Pandemic, Snowblind, and SCEE London Development Studio.

CMP Technology's 2008 Game Developers Conference (GDC) has announced five new members for its advisory board, each with considerable talent, knowledge and experience in video game design and visual arts. The new additions "...reflect the GDC's response to both evolving industry and attendee input for even more visual arts and design content for the event", according to a statement from the organizers. The new members of the GDC '08 advisory board are: - Carey Chico, studio art director at Pandemic Studios, who first started at Activision Studios as an animator on Planetfall, and went on to work as lead artist on Battlezone before becoming a founding member of Pandemic Studios. More recently, Chico has overseen work on Full Spectrum Warrior, Battlefront, Mercenaries, and Destroy All Humans. - John Feil, designer at Snowblind Studios, whose industry duties have spanned from quality assurance, to technical writing, and finally to level designer, and designer. Currently, Feil is a system designer for Snowblind Studios, the chairman of the IGDA’a Credits Committee, and co-author of Course Technology’s Beginning Game Level Design. - Ichiro Otobe, chief strategist at Square Enix, who joined the company in 2003, serving as the president of Square Enix Inc., the U.S. arm of Square Enix, until 2005. - Rob Pardo, vice president of game design at Blizzard Entertainment, who supervises the overall design and implementation of game-play features for every Blizzard game, including World of Warcraft, after joining in 1997 as a designer and strike-team member on the real-time strategy game StarCraft. - Dave Ranyard, creative services manager at Sony Computer Entertainment Europe's London Development Studio, who is responsible for the following departments: audio, music, graphic design, and video, and has worked on titles such as Wip3Out, The Getaway & The Getaway: Black Monday, and the EyeToy and Singstar brands. Said GDC executive director Jamil Moledina, "In order to continue to push global game creation forward, we have refreshed our own content development team with a mix of international, art, design, and online thought leaders. We are extremely excited and grateful to be working with all the cutting-edge developers of the GDC Advisory Board in crafting the vision and curriculum of GDC 08."
